Given a makeover in 2015, CEPTETEB became the primary mobile banking channel for TEB’s retail customers. In early 2020, TEB introduced CEPTETEB İŞTE (“CEPTETEB For Business”), a version of the app specifically designed for its SME, corporate, and microbusiness banking customers. TEB Corporate Banking focuses on providing large-scale national and international firms, corporate groups, and holding companies with high-added-value corporate banking products and services. As of end-2019, TEB had about nine thousand employees on its payroll and was serving customers through extensive branch and ATM networks, its CEPTETEB and CEPTETEB İŞTE mobile apps, an online banking website, and a call center.

Three TEB subsidiaries offer services: TEB Faktoring AŞ is one of the most active players in Turkey’s factoring industry and has been providing corporate and commercial firms as well as SMEs with export, import, and domestic factoring products and services since 1997. TEB Portföy Yönetimi AŞ is an asset management company that has been in business since 1999. TEB Yatırım Menkul Değerler AŞ, which commenced operations in 1996, is a brokerage house that carries out capital market transactions on behalf of customers in accordance with the requirements of Turkish capital market laws and regulations.
